DEP (Data Execution Prevention) – это встроенная функция операционной системы Windows, которая предотвращает запуск и выполнение вредоносного кода на компьютере. Она обеспечивает дополнительный уровень защиты, блокируя запуск программ, которые пытаются использовать память компьютера неправильно или злонамеренно.
Однако иногда пользователи сталкиваются с ситуацией, когда DEP мешает работе определенных программ, особенно старых или совместимых утилит. В таких случаях возникает потребность в отключении DEP. В этом полном руководстве мы покажем вам, как отключить DEP в Windows, чтобы устранить эти проблемы.
Важно помнить, что отключение DEP может потенциально повысить уязвимость вашей системы для вредоносного программного обеспечения, поэтому рекомендуется отключать DEP только в случаях, когда это действительно необходимо, и только для проверенных программ.
Продолжая чтение этой статьи, вы узнаете два способа отключить DEP в Windows: с использованием системных настроек и с помощью командной строки. Мы объясним оба метода шаг за шагом, чтобы вы могли выбрать наиболее удобный для вас способ и успешно отключить DEP на вашем компьютере.
DEP в Windows — что это и зачем нужно знать?
DEP работает путем предотвращения выполнения кода из областей памяти, предназначенных только для хранения данных. Это помогает предотвратить буферные переполнения — один из самых распространенных типов атак, при которых злоумышленник может исполнять свой вредоносный код на компьютере.
DEP может быть настроен в операционной системе Windows в двух режимах:
- DEP включен для всех программ и служб: в этом режиме DEP применяется ко всем программам и службам на компьютере. Он может предотвратить выполнение вредоносного кода и обеспечить дополнительную защиту.
- DEP включен только для основных программ и служб: в этом режиме DEP применяется только к операционной системе Windows и основным программам. Это может быть полезно, если у вас возникают проблемы совместимости с какими-либо приложениями.
Знание о DEP и его настройке важно для пользователей Windows, поскольку это помогает улучшить безопасность компьютера и защитить его от потенциальных угроз. В данном руководстве вы узнаете, как отключить или настроить DEP в Windows в зависимости от ваших потребностей.
Как включить DEP на вашем компьютере?
Шаг 1:
Нажмите правой кнопкой мыши на значок «Мой компьютер» на рабочем столе или в меню «Пуск». В открывшемся контекстном меню выберите пункт «Свойства».
Шаг 2:
В окне «Свойства системы» выберите вкладку «Дополнительно».
Шаг 3:
В разделе «Производительность» нажмите кнопку «Настройки».
Шаг 4:
В открывшемся окне «Настройка производительности» выберите вкладку «Предотвращение выполнения данных».
Шаг 5:
Выберите вариант «Включить DEP для всех программ и служб» и нажмите кнопку «Применить».
Шаг 6:
После завершения процедуры включения DEP может потребоваться перезагрузка компьютера. Если это необходимо, выберите опцию «Перезагрузить сейчас» и нажмите кнопку «ОК».
Поздравляю! Вы успешно включили DEP на вашем компьютере. Теперь ваша система будет более защищена от вредоносного кода и вредоносных программ.
DEP и совместимость с программами
Если у вас возникли проблемы с запуском или работой программы из-за DEP, вы можете отключить его для этой программы. Для этого нужно выполнить следующие шаги:
- Зайдите в «Панель управления» и выберите «Система».
- Нажмите на вкладку «Дополнительные параметры системы».
- В открывшемся окне нажмите на кнопку «Настройки» в разделе «Защита от выполнения данных».
- В окне «Настройки DEP» выберите опцию «Включить DEP только для обязательных программ и служб» и нажмите кнопку «Добавить».
- Найдите исполняемый файл программы, для которой вы хотите отключить DEP, и выберите его.
- Нажмите «Открыть» и затем «ОК» во всех открытых окнах.
После выполнения этих шагов DEP будет отключен для выбранной программы, и она сможет работать без проблем. Однако, помните, что отключение DEP может негативно сказаться на безопасности вашей системы, поэтому рекомендуется быть осторожным и включать его только при необходимости.
Обратите внимание: если вы испытываете проблемы с запуском или работой нескольких программ, не рекомендуется отключать DEP полностью. В этом случае лучше попробовать найти другие способы решить проблему, например, обновить программу или связаться с разработчиком для получения поддержки.
Как отключить DEP в Windows 10?
Компонент DEP (Data Execution Prevention) в Windows 10 нужен для обеспечения безопасности системы, предотвращая запуск вредоносных программ. Однако, в некоторых случаях, пользователю может потребоваться временно или постоянно отключить DEP. В этом разделе мы рассмотрим, как это сделать.
Прежде чем отключать DEP, стоит учитывать, что это может снизить безопасность вашей системы. Рекомендуется отключать DEP только в тех случаях, когда это действительно необходимо и только при использовании проверенного и надежного программного обеспечения.
Есть два способа отключить DEP в Windows 10: через системные настройки и при помощи инструмента командной строки.
Способ | Описание |
---|---|
Отключение DEP через системные настройки |
|
Отключение DEP при помощи командной строки |
|
После отключения DEP рекомендуется периодически проверять наличие обновлений для вашей операционной системы и устанавливать их, чтобы поддерживать безопасность системы на максимальном уровне.
Отключение DEP в Windows 7 и Windows 8
Чтобы отключить DEP в Windows 7 или Windows 8, следуйте этим шагам:
- Откройте «Панель управления» с помощью поиска в меню «Пуск».
- В поисковой строке «Панели управления» введите «система» и выберите «Система и безопасность».
- Выберите «Система» и затем «Дополнительные параметры системы».
- В окне «Свойства системы» перейдите на вкладку «Дополнительно».
- Нажмите кнопку «Настройка» в разделе «Производительность».
- В открывшемся окне «Настройка производительности» перейдите на вкладку «Защита данных».
- Выберите опцию «Включить DEP для всех программ и служб, за исключением указанных ниже» и нажмите кнопку «Добавить».
- Выберите программу или процесс, для которого хотите отключить DEP, и нажмите кнопку «Открыть».
- Нажмите «Применить» и затем «ОК», чтобы сохранить изменения.
После выполнения этих шагов DEP будет отключен для выбранной программы или процесса. Учтите, что отключение DEP может повысить уязвимость вашей системы к вредоносному коду, поэтому будьте осторожны и отключайте DEP только для доверенных программ или процессов.
Обратите внимание, что некоторые программы или процессы могут все равно использовать DEP, даже если вы отключили его в Windows. В таком случае, вам могут потребоваться дополнительные настройки программы или обратитесь к разработчику программы за дополнительной информацией.
DEP и безопасность системы
DEP (Data Execution Prevention) представляет собой механизм безопасности, встроенный в операционные системы Windows. Он предотвращает выполнение кода в определенных областях памяти, которые должны быть доступны только для хранения данных.
DEP способствует защите системы от атак, связанных с выполнением вредоносного кода, таких как атаки буферного переполнения. Он следит за тем, какая память используется для выполнения кода, и блокирует попытки выполнения кода из областей памяти, которые должны использоваться только для хранения данных.
DEP можно настроить для работы в двух режимах: аппаратном и программном. Режим аппаратной реализации DEP требует наличия поддерживаемого процессора, который поддерживает функцию NX (No Execute). В этом режиме DEP блокирует выполнение кода в определенных областях памяти и обеспечивает дополнительную защиту системы.
Режим программной реализации DEP не требует специального аппаратного обеспечения и основан на программных настройках. В этом режиме DEP блокирует только известные вредоносные программы и скрипты, не трогая легальные приложения.
Активация DEP в системе способствует повышению безопасности компьютера и снижению риска подвергнуться атаке злоумышленников. При использовании DEP рекомендуется также регулярно обновлять операционную систему и программное обеспечение, чтобы минимизировать риски безопасности и позволить DEP эффективно работать.